Hello,
I try to build the Asus merlin on Ubuntu LTS under virtual boxe .
I follow all the wiki (https://github.com/RMerl/asuswrt-merlin/wiki/Compile-Firmware-from-source-using-Ubuntu), check the debian wiki too, perform the modifications indicated at the end of the wiki, cross around the web, add several packages... but nothing, download again (and again, and again... the git directory). But Nothing. I always have the ****** following error (I spent more than 2 weeks on it..).
So, hope you can help me.. else... I will take a revenge on my ice cream !!
make[5]: 'include/generated/mach-types.h' is up to date.
CALL scripts/checksyscalls.sh
CHK include/generated/compile.h
Kernel: arch/arm/boot/Image is ready
SHIPPED arch/arm/boot/compressed/mpcore_cache.S
SHIPPED arch/arm/boot/compressed/lib1funcs.S
AS arch/arm/boot/compressed/mpcore_cache.o
AS arch/arm/boot/compressed/lib1funcs.o
LD arch/arm/boot/compressed/vmlinux
OBJCOPY arch/arm/boot/zImage
Kernel: arch/arm/boot/zImage is ready
make[4]: Leaving directory '/home/dede/asuswrt-merlin/release/src-rt-6.x.4708/linux/linux-2.6.36'
make[4]: Entering directory '/home/dede/asuswrt-merlin/release/src-rt-6.x.4708/linux/linux-2.6.36'
CHK include/linux/version.h
CHK include/generated/utsrelease.h
make[5]: 'include/generated/mach-types.h' is up to date.
CALL scripts/checksyscalls.sh
LD [M] drivers/net/ctf/ctf.o
LD [M] drivers/net/wl/wl.o
Building modules, stage 2.
MODPOST 143 modules
WARNING: could not find drivers/net/ctf/../../../../../../src-rt-6.x.4708/router/ctf_arm//linux/.ctf.o.cmd for drivers/net/ctf/../../../../../../src-rt-6.x.4708/router/ctf_arm//linux/ctf.o
WARNING: could not find drivers/net/emf/../../../../../../src-rt-6.x.4708/router/emf_arm/.emf.o.cmd for drivers/net/emf/../../../../../../src-rt-6.x.4708/router/emf_arm/emf.o
WARNING: could not find drivers/net/igs/../../../../../../src-rt-6.x.4708/router/emf_arm/.igs.o.cmd for drivers/net/igs/../../../../../../src-rt-6.x.4708/router/emf_arm/igs.o
WARNING: could not find drivers/net/wl/../../../../../../src-rt-6.x.4708/wl/linux/.wl_apsta.o.cmd for drivers/net/wl/../../../../../../src-rt-6.x.4708/wl/linux/wl_apsta.o
LD [M] drivers/net/ctf/ctf.ko
LD [M] drivers/net/wl/wl.ko
make[4]: Leaving directory '/home/dede/asuswrt-merlin/release/src-rt-6.x.4708/linux/linux-2.6.36'
# Preserve the debug versions of these and strip for release
make[3]: Leaving directory '/home/dede/asuswrt-merlin/release/src/router'
Makefile:202: recipe for target 'all' failed
make[2]: *** [all] Error 2
make[2]: Leaving directory '/home/dede/asuswrt-merlin/release/src-rt-6.x.4708'
Makefile:2821: recipe for target 'bin' failed
make[1]: *** [bin] Error 2
make[1]: Leaving directory '/home/dede/asuswrt-merlin/release/src-rt-6.x.4708'
Makefile:2891: recipe for target 'rt-ac68u' failed
make: *** [rt-ac68u] Error 2
I start from an ubuntu LTS from scratch, so there is nothing more than the required packages indicated in the wiki.
Many thanks from the Japan
I try to build the Asus merlin on Ubuntu LTS under virtual boxe .
I follow all the wiki (https://github.com/RMerl/asuswrt-merlin/wiki/Compile-Firmware-from-source-using-Ubuntu), check the debian wiki too, perform the modifications indicated at the end of the wiki, cross around the web, add several packages... but nothing, download again (and again, and again... the git directory). But Nothing. I always have the ****** following error (I spent more than 2 weeks on it..).
So, hope you can help me.. else... I will take a revenge on my ice cream !!
make[5]: 'include/generated/mach-types.h' is up to date.
CALL scripts/checksyscalls.sh
CHK include/generated/compile.h
Kernel: arch/arm/boot/Image is ready
SHIPPED arch/arm/boot/compressed/mpcore_cache.S
SHIPPED arch/arm/boot/compressed/lib1funcs.S
AS arch/arm/boot/compressed/mpcore_cache.o
AS arch/arm/boot/compressed/lib1funcs.o
LD arch/arm/boot/compressed/vmlinux
OBJCOPY arch/arm/boot/zImage
Kernel: arch/arm/boot/zImage is ready
make[4]: Leaving directory '/home/dede/asuswrt-merlin/release/src-rt-6.x.4708/linux/linux-2.6.36'
make[4]: Entering directory '/home/dede/asuswrt-merlin/release/src-rt-6.x.4708/linux/linux-2.6.36'
CHK include/linux/version.h
CHK include/generated/utsrelease.h
make[5]: 'include/generated/mach-types.h' is up to date.
CALL scripts/checksyscalls.sh
LD [M] drivers/net/ctf/ctf.o
LD [M] drivers/net/wl/wl.o
Building modules, stage 2.
MODPOST 143 modules
WARNING: could not find drivers/net/ctf/../../../../../../src-rt-6.x.4708/router/ctf_arm//linux/.ctf.o.cmd for drivers/net/ctf/../../../../../../src-rt-6.x.4708/router/ctf_arm//linux/ctf.o
WARNING: could not find drivers/net/emf/../../../../../../src-rt-6.x.4708/router/emf_arm/.emf.o.cmd for drivers/net/emf/../../../../../../src-rt-6.x.4708/router/emf_arm/emf.o
WARNING: could not find drivers/net/igs/../../../../../../src-rt-6.x.4708/router/emf_arm/.igs.o.cmd for drivers/net/igs/../../../../../../src-rt-6.x.4708/router/emf_arm/igs.o
WARNING: could not find drivers/net/wl/../../../../../../src-rt-6.x.4708/wl/linux/.wl_apsta.o.cmd for drivers/net/wl/../../../../../../src-rt-6.x.4708/wl/linux/wl_apsta.o
LD [M] drivers/net/ctf/ctf.ko
LD [M] drivers/net/wl/wl.ko
make[4]: Leaving directory '/home/dede/asuswrt-merlin/release/src-rt-6.x.4708/linux/linux-2.6.36'
# Preserve the debug versions of these and strip for release
make[3]: Leaving directory '/home/dede/asuswrt-merlin/release/src/router'
Makefile:202: recipe for target 'all' failed
make[2]: *** [all] Error 2
make[2]: Leaving directory '/home/dede/asuswrt-merlin/release/src-rt-6.x.4708'
Makefile:2821: recipe for target 'bin' failed
make[1]: *** [bin] Error 2
make[1]: Leaving directory '/home/dede/asuswrt-merlin/release/src-rt-6.x.4708'
Makefile:2891: recipe for target 'rt-ac68u' failed
make: *** [rt-ac68u] Error 2
I start from an ubuntu LTS from scratch, so there is nothing more than the required packages indicated in the wiki.
Many thanks from the Japan